The Sample Letter Acceptance Offer With Current Employer in Ohio serves as a formal communication tool for individuals accepting a job offer from their current employer. It outlines critical elements such as job position, supervisory responsibilities, and annual salary agreements, making it essential for maintaining clarity and professionalism in employment communications. This form is particularly useful for legal professionals, including att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ants, as it reinforces a structured approach to employment agreements and fosters positive employer-employee relationships. Users can edit the template to include specific details relevant to their circumstances, allowing for customization to meet their needs. The simple and clear language ensures accessibility for users with varying levels of legal expertise. This form also highlights the importance of reconfirming verbal agreements in writing, thereby minimizing misunderstandings. By utilizing this letter, users can effectively communicate their acceptance of the offer while affirming their commitment to the company and its goals.

Consider how sharing the offer might affect your current job. If your boss knows you're considering other offers, it could change the dynamic of your current role. If you're open to staying with your current company, you could use the offer as leverage in negotiations without sharing the specific details.
